Antigua and Barbuda's internet penetration has reached 78% in 2026, reflecting increased digital adoption driven by mobile access and improved infrastructure. The rise in mobile web traffic to 65% indicates a shift towards smartphones as primary devices for browsing, supporting the nation's growing digital economy and online services.
E-commerce sales continue to expand at 15%, showcasing the country's shift towards digital commerce, especially in tourism and retail sectors. The average daily website visits per user of 4.2 and a bounce rate of 42% suggest active online engagement, though there's room for improvement in website content to retain visitors longer and increase conversions.
